Least Common Multiple of 93125 and 93137 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 93125 and 93137, than apply into the LCM equation.

GCF(93125,93137) = 1
LCM(93125,93137) = ( 93125 × 93137) / 1
LCM(93125,93137) = 8673383125 / 1
LCM(93125,93137) = 8673383125
